Output 4dc581fe01ec6fd1764638628c736d8d663af2b7598fbb38f6a7d9a8383de637:0

value
6980343527577
script pubkey
OP_0 OP_PUSHBYTES_20 f51fc669f3407849ac84553d39afa416fcbf04d4
address
tb1q750uv60ngpuyntyy257nntayzm7t7px5hswwj6
transaction
4dc581fe01ec6fd1764638628c736d8d663af2b7598fbb38f6a7d9a8383de637
confirmations
163361
spent
true